Student Employment Programs. Where for employment equity or work experience program purposes the University intends to establish a position within the scope of the bargaining unit, there must be mutual agreement regarding the creation and terms of the assignment including rates of pay before it can proceed. Student Employment will be classified as a casual assignment under the terms of this agreement. The Union will not unreasonably withhold agreement to the appointment of Student Employment positions. Student Employment positions will be in addition to the Auditorium’s existing positions. In no case will such hiring’s result in the termination, layoff, or reduction of hours of an employee.
